Sustaining vs. Disruptive Innovation (Clayton Christensen)

​Sustaining Innovation: Improving existing products for established customers (e.g., the iPhone 14 to iPhone 15).

​Disruptive Innovation: Creating a new market by applying a different set of values, often starting small and simple before displacing incumbents (e.g., Netflix displacing Blockbuster).

​It’s easy to get caught in the trap of Sustaining Innovation—making existing products better, faster, and slightly cheaper for your best customers. This is essential, but it won’t protect you forever.

​True Disruptive Innovation rarely looks impressive at first. It usually starts as a simpler, cheaper alternative that captures a small, ignored market segment. While the incumbents ignore the "toy," it improves rapidly.

​By the time the market leaders notice, the disruption has already moved upmarket.
